I'd like to know if it is possible to take a GFS filesystem on a RHEL
3u8 system to RHEL 5u1.  I have seen steps to convert GFS 6.0 to GFS
6.1, and 6.1 to 2, but I don't see any way to go directly from 6.0 to
2.
